Why some metals cause skin reactions
Most earring-related skin reactions trace back to nickel. This inexpensive metal is often used as a base or alloy in fashion jewelry because it adds strength and shine. When nickel comes into prolonged contact with skin, especially in the warm, slightly moist environment of an earlobe piercing, it can trigger an allergic response—redness, itching, swelling, or even blistering. The reaction isn’t immediate; it builds over hours or days of wear, which is why you might not connect the dots right away.
Another culprit is copper oxidation. When copper alloys (common in brass or low-quality “gold” plating) interact with sweat and air, they form greenish salts that can stain skin. This isn’t an allergy—it’s a chemical reaction—but it’s uncomfortable and unsightly. Plated metals also wear thin over time, exposing the reactive base metal underneath. That’s why “hypoallergenic” claims mean nothing without knowing what’s actually in the alloy.
Safe metal options for sensitive skin
When shopping for earrings that won’t irritate, look for metals that are either nickel-free by composition or so inert they don’t react with skin. Here’s a practical ranking from most to least widely tolerated:
- S925 sterling silver – 92.5% pure silver, alloyed with copper (not nickel). Genuine S925 is stamped and widely considered hypoallergenic. Look for the hallmark.
- Surgical-grade stainless steel – Typically 316L or 304 grade, nickel-free and highly resistant to corrosion. Ideal for magnetic or non-piercing styles because it’s lightweight and durable.
- 14K+ solid gold – Yellow, white, or rose gold above 14K contains less nickel and is generally safe, but verify the alloy—some white gold uses nickel for whitening.
- Titanium – Completely biocompatible, used in medical implants. Extremely lightweight and never contains nickel.
- Niobium – Similar to titanium, hypoallergenic and available in anodized colors.
For most people with mild to moderate sensitivity, S925 sterling silver and surgical stainless steel are the sweet spot—affordable, widely available, and genuinely comfortable. Below is a quick side-by-side to help you decide.

How to identify truly hypoallergenic earrings
A “hypoallergenic” label isn’t regulated, so you need to read between the lines. Use this checklist before you buy:
- Look for a hallmark. Sterling silver should be stamped “925” or “S925.” Stainless steel pieces may be marked “316L” or “304.” No stamp? It’s probably an alloy you can’t trust.
- Check for a nickel-free declaration. Reputable brands explicitly state “nickel-free” or “free of nickel and lead.” If the description only says “hypoallergenic” without specifics, dig deeper.
- Examine the plating. Gold- or rose-gold-tone finishes are often achieved with PVD coating on stainless steel, which is durable and skin-safe. Avoid thin electroplating over mystery brass—it wears off fast.

What to avoid (red flag materials)
Steer clear of these when you have sensitive ears:
- Plated brass or bronze. The base metal contains copper and often nickel; the thin gold or silver layer wears off quickly, exposing reactive metal directly to your skin.
- “Mystery metal” fashion jewelry. If the label says “metal alloy” without specifying the components, assume it contains nickel.
- Nickel silver. Despite the name, it contains zero silver—it’s a copper-nickel-zinc alloy that’s a common irritant.
- Costume jewelry with glued-on stones. Adhesives can contain chemicals that trigger contact dermatitis, and the metal underneath is rarely skin-safe.

Common questions
Is stainless steel really hypoallergenic?
Surgical-grade stainless steel (304 or 316L) is considered hypoallergenic because it’s formulated without nickel. It’s widely used in medical tools and body jewelry. However, some people with extreme nickel sensitivity may still react to trace amounts, so always check for a “nickel-free” guarantee.
Can sterling silver cause skin reactions?
Genuine S925 sterling silver is 92.5% pure silver, with the remaining 7.5% usually copper. Copper allergies are extremely rare, so sterling silver is safe for the vast majority of sensitive ears. The bigger risk is fake “silver” that’s actually plated nickel alloy—always look for the 925 stamp.
How do I know if my earrings are nickel-free?
Read the product description carefully. Reputable jewelers list the full metal composition. If it says “nickel-free,” “surgical steel,” or “S925 sterling silver,” you’re on solid ground. Avoid anything labeled only “alloy” or “mixed metal.”
